Glen Allan Pettigrove is an American philosopher and Chair of Moral Philosophy at the University of Glasgow.[1] He is known for his expertise on philosophy of emotions.[2][3][4][5]

Career

Pettigrove has taught at the University of Auckland (2008-2017), Massey University (2005-2008) and Santa Clara University (2003–2005).[6]
